THE MILLENNIAL REIGN OF CHRIST (1,000 YEARS)
Jesus will be King (Isa. 9:6) of the Earth, ruling from Jerusalem (Mic. 4:1-2) for 1,000
years (Rv. 20:1-6; Zch. 14:9, 16; Isa. 2:1-4, 11:1-10, 35:1-10), where the nations will
come to worship (Zch. 14:16) and learn of God’s ways (Mic. 4:2; Zch. 8:3). The
Millennium will start off with believers only (Jn. 3:3; Mt. 25:31-34, 41, 46) and will be
marked by a unified government (Hos. 1:11), where church age believers and
Tribulation martyrs will co-reign with Christ (Rv. 20:6; 2 Tim. 2:12). David will be the
prince of Israel (Ezk. 34:22-24); Jesus’s apostles will judge the twelve tribes of Israel
(Mt.19:28; Lk. 22:29-30); all weapons of war will be destroyed (Isa. 2:4); there will be
no wars (Mic. 4:3); there will be a worldwide knowledge of God (Isa. 11:9), peace
(Isa. 9:6-7), justice (Isa.11:3-5), obedience (Dan. 7:27), holiness (Ezk. 36:24-31,
37:23-24), the fullness of the Holy Spirit (Joel 2:28-29) and an increase in joy (Isa.
9:3-4, 14:7). Children will be born (Isa.11:6, 65:20, 23; Jer. 30:20) by those in their
natural bodies (i.e., survivors of the Tribulation and their offspring). There will also
be a prolonged life expectancy for those in their natural bodies. There will be
comfort for those who would sorrow (Isa.12:1, 35:10, 65:19), a removal of sickness
(Isa. 33:24, Jer. 30:17), healing of the deformed (Isa. 35:5-6), fruitful, enjoyable labor
(Isa. 62-8-9, 65:21-23), one language (Zeph.3:9), a change in the nature of ferocious
animals (Isa.11:6-9; Ezk. 34:25, Isa. 65:25), wonderful changes to the environment
(Isa. 35:1-2, 6b-7, 55:13) and a Millennial temple in Jerusalem where sacrifices will
be made in remembrance to Christ’s death (Ezk. 40-46). This period is also know as
“THE MARRIAGESUPPER OF LAMB” (Rv.19:9).

NEBUCHADNEZZAR’S DREAM OF COMING KINGDOMS THAT WOULD
PRECEDE THE ESTABLISHING OF GOD’S KINGDOM ON EARTH
God gave the interpretation of Nebuchadnezzar’s dream to Daniel in Daniel chapter 2. The
interpretation includes the prophecy that God would set up an everlasting kingdom during
the time of the ten kings of the revived Roman Empire (see 4b below). Daniel said, “And in the
days of these kings the God of Heaven will set up a kingdom which shall never be destroyed;
and the kingdom shall not be left to other people; it shall break in pieces and consume all
these kingdoms, and it shall stand forever.” (Daniel 2:44) This will happen when Jesus returns
to the Earth immediately after the Tribulation.

EZEKIEL 38 & 39 prophesies about a great military invasion against Israel by countries such as Iran, Libya, Sudan, Turkey, and Russia. This battle
will most likely happen during the first 3.5 years of the Tribulation when Israel is dwelling in the land securely and at peace (see Ezk. 38:11,14). See
Dwight Pentecost’s Things to Come (p. 347) where he discusses the problems with the view that this battle occurs prior to, or at the end of the Tribulation.

RESURRECTION OF TRIBULATION MARTYRS (Rv. 20:4)
& OLD TESTAMENT SAINTS
(Dan. 12:1-2; Isa. 26:19; Jn. 5:28-29a)
This resurrection is only “first” (Rv. 20:5) in the sense that it will be
before the resurrection of the wicked (Rv. 20:12-13). The resurrection
of martyrs and Old Testament saints will occur after the Second
Coming (Rv. 19:11-21) and prior to the Millennium (Rv. 20:2-6).
Concerning the timing of the OT saints resurrection, Dan.12:1 makes
it clear that it will happen after the “time of distress.”
